Win 8 pro is just Windows, it will run most PC software. The CPU on the tablet will determine how many plugs you will run, same as Laptop. Youll have varying success with touch control. Avoid Win 8 RT, its not compatible with Windows PC software. The cheaper tablets are RT.

Like UltraJv said. Look for a laptop that runs Windows 8 Pro, not RT. Basically, the ultra laptops are almost in the same league as tablets, but they can do much more. Depending on how portable you want to be, if you want to spend around 1.000 USD, you can get very good ultra laptops with touch and a very powerful CPU, capable of running many plug-ins (in Windows) and still have the touch environment for the portable needs.
